#7d40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d40ec is composed of 49% red, 25.1%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47% cyan, 72.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 261.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 58.8%. #7d40ec color hex could be obtained by blending #fa80ff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#7d40ec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7d40ec has RGB values of R:125, G:64,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 8208620.

Hex triplet 7d40ec #7d40ec
RGB Decimal 125, 64, 236 rgb(125,64,236)
RGB Percent 49, 25.1, 92.5 rgb(49%,25.1%,92.5%)
CMYK 47, 73, 0, 7
HSL 261.3°, 81.9, 58.8 hsl(261.3,81.9%,58.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 261.3°, 72.9, 92.5
Web Safe 6633ff #6633ff
CIE-LAB 44.351, 62.045, -76.965
XYZ 25.429, 14.083, 80.731
xyY 0.211, 0.117, 14.083
CIE-LCH 44.351, 98.859, 308.874
CIE-LUV 44.351, 8.4, -117.422
Hunter-Lab 37.527, 55.281, -101.281
Binary 01111101, 01000000, 11101100

Shades and Tints of #7d40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020105 is the darkest color, while #f6f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d40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94919b is the less saturated color, while #7830fc is the most saturated one.
